#474640 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#474640 is composed of 27.8% red, 27.5%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.4% magenta, 9.9% yellow and 72.2% black. It has a hue angle of 51.4 degrees, a saturation of 5.2% and a lightness of 26.5%. #474640 color hex could be obtained by blending #8e8c80 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#474640 color description : Very dark grayish yellow.

#474640 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#474640 has RGB values of R:71, G:70,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.01, Y:0.1, K:0.72. Its decimal value is 4671040.

Shades and Tints of #474640

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090908 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#474640

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474640 is the less saturated color, while #857302 is the most saturated one.
